A. Aim
1. To determine the number of platelets in the blood cells probandus
2. To determine whether the patient had dengue fever
B. Principle
Blood was diluted using a solution containing the brilliant cresyl blue who
would paint platelets become somewhat colored light blue. then calculated using the
platelet count room
C. tools and materials
1. tools
a) Thoma pipette erythrocytes
b) room count
c) deck glass
d) microscope
e) tube vial
f) 3cc syringe
g) Aspirator
2. Materials
a) Blood + EDTA
b) hayem solution (sodium citrate 3.8 gram ,formaldehyde solution 40% ,
brilliant cresyl blue 30 gram ,aquadest 100 ml
D procedure
a) equipment and materials to be used.
b) do pemipetandarah using a pipette Thoma erytrosit to right on a 0.5 scale and
clean the outside of the pipette with a tissue.
c) Ecker rees continue pipetting solution up to a scale of 101 (do it carefully to
avoid bubbles).
d) homogenize the solution for 15-30 seconds, discard the solution of 3-4 drops.
e) dripping the solution on the surface of the counting chamber were already in
the cover glass deck until blended, on its own capacity.
f) let the counting chamber for 2-3 minutes to allow platelets to settle, then
continue to read the number of platelet cells under a microscope with a
magnification of 40X.
